预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于移动Agent的分布式计算研究与实现的中期报告 一、选题背景 随着云计算、大数据和物联网技术的发展,分布式计算越来越受到关注。移动Agent在分布式计算中具有的优势,如弹性、透明性、安全性等使得其成为分布式计算中重要的一种技术。本课题旨在探究移动Agent在分布式计算中的应用,并实现一个基于移动Agent的分布式计算系统。 二、研究内容与进展 1.研究内容 本课题的研究内容包括如下几个方面: (1)移动Agent的概念与特点 (2)基于移动Agent的分布式计算的架构设计 (3)移动Agent的路由、安全和通信技术 (4)移动Agent在数据采集、处理和分析中的应用 2.进展情况 在选题后的前期工作中,我们主要进行了移动Agent相关技术的学习和分析,包括移动Agent的基本概念、特点、路由、安全和通信技术等。了解了移动Agent在分布式计算中的应用,掌握了Agent程序的开发技术,并学习了相关分布式计算平台的搭建和使用。 在实际操作中,我们利用Java语言编写了一个简单的移动Agent程序,实现了Agent的基本功能。同时,我们还构建了一个基于JavaAgentDevelopmentFramework(JADE)的分布式计算系统。在该系统中,我们使用了移动Agent来实现分布式计算,并实现了数据的采集、处理和展示等功能。 三、存在问题与解决方案 1.存在问题 (1)在Agent的路由和通信技术中,由于对Agent相关技术的理解不够深入,导致在实现过程中遇到了一些问题。 (2)在Agent程序的开发中,由于经验不足,导致程序的性能等方面存在改进的空间。 2.解决方案 (1)针对第一个问题,我们将继续深入学习Agent相关技术,包括路由和通信技术,并结合实际应用场景对技术进行实践。 (2)针对第二个问题,我们将继续加强对编程技巧和编程规范等方面的学习,并对程序的性能等方面进行改进。 四、下一步工作计划 1.继续深入学习Agent相关技术,包括路由、安全和通信技术等。 2.进一步完善移动Agent程序,并对程序的性能等方面进行优化。 3.将重点放在移动Agent在数据采集、处理和分析中的应用,继续探索移动Agent的应用场景。 4.设计和实现基于移动Agent的分布式计算系统,并进行测试和优化。